What is baptism?

Baptism is a way of publicly saying, “I have decided to follow Jesus.”

Throughout the New Testament, people who put their faith in Jesus responded by being baptized. Jesus Himself was baptized, and He invited His followers to baptize others in the name of the Father, Son, and Holy Spirit.

At Advent Hope, we practice baptism by immersion—being lowered beneath the water and raised again—as a symbol of Jesus’ death, burial, and resurrection.

Going beneath the water represents leaving our old life behind. Rising from the water points to the new life we have in Christ.
